Omni 56K Plus Series User's Guide Table 4-12 Voice AT Commands COMMAND FUNCTION OPTION DEFAULT DESCRIPTION +VGR Set the gain 0 for the received voice sample. 0 0: Automatic gain control(AGC) +VGT Set the gain for the transmitted voice sample. 0-255 128 0: Silence 1-255: The larger the value, the louder the voice will be. +VLS Select a voice 0,1, 2 I/O device. 0 0: The DCE is on hook. Local phone connected to Telco line. 1: The DCE is on-hook and is connected to the local phone. The local phone is also provided with power. The modem can record/play through the local phone set. 2: The DCE is off-hook and is connected to the Telephone line. The local phone is provided with power. The modem can record/play through the local telephone line. +VRA Ring back goes away timer 0 - 255 70 0: turn off the timer 1-255: Defines the period without ringback (after at lease one ringback has been detected) in 100 -ms units. +VRN Ring back never come timer 0 - 255 10 0: turn off the timer 1-255: Defines the period without ringback after dialing in 1 sec unit. +VTX Voice transmit NA mode NA Switches to voice transmit mode. +VSD Silence detection Threshold, Period (0-255), (0-255) 15,70 Threshold: 0: Disable silence detection. 1-255: The smaller the value, the more sensitive to the silence detection it will be. Period: 1-255: The required period of silence detection before DCE reporting the silence event. 0: Disable silence detection. Unit: 0.1 second +VSM Selection of compression method 4;ZyXEL ADPCM; 4,9600 4 Bit;(9600) IMA 4 bit ADPCM. Sample rate: 9600 +VTS= Dual Tone x: 0-3000 Hz NA [x,y,z] Generation y: 0-3000 Hz x: first tone frequency y: second tone frequency z: 0- 1000(10ms) z: duration in 10ms unit +VTS= {x,y} DTMF Tone x:0-9,*,#, A-D NA Generation y:0-1000 (10ms) x: DTMF digits (0-9,*,#, A,B,C,D) y: duration in 10ms unit Command Sets 4-17
